Cork and slice - Line your knife up with the edge of your guide and apply even, firm pressure along the straightedge to cut through the cork. Thinner sheets, like ¼” or 1/8” natural tan or thinner can usually be cut all the way through in a single pass. Cork rings are sold separately. Slicing Jig The Cork Slicer is designed to handle standard 1 1/4" cork, burl and colored rings. The slicer is designed to cut 1/8" slices out of the rings. In using different types of shim materials you can use it to cut the slices as thin as 1/32". The sound of a chair scraping across your beautiful floor can make your skin crawl. Solve the problem by cutting cork into thin slices and attaching them to the bottom of the chair legs with a spot of wood glue. Use the scissors to cut through the cork. Hold the cork in your nondominant hand and open the blades of the scissors. Press them against the edge of the cork and slowly close the handles to cut through the board. If you look at a living matter with a microscope — even a simple light microscope — you will see that it consists of cells. Cells are the basic units of the structure and function of living things. They are the smallest units that can carry out the processes of life. All organisms are made up of ...Protective tissues are an essential aspect of the plant tissue system. The epidermal cells and cork cells are two kinds of protective cells found in the peripheral layer of the plant. Epidermal cells are organised in a solitary layer to cover the entire plant body. All organisms are made up of ...May 26, 2023 · Cut corks into 1 ⁄ 2 inch (1.3 cm) slices to create wine charms. After cutting the corks, use an ice pick or metal skewer to poke a hole near the edge of each slice. Slide a 2 to 3 inch (5.1 to 7.6 cm) length of thin, flexible wire or twine through the hole. The Custom Builder Cork Slicer and Checkerboard cutting jigs (MHCJ-1) are all that you will need to create the ultimate in custom cork and Eva Handles. With these two jigs you will be able to slice cork or EVA into discs of 1/8” or smaller and cut rings into checkerboard wedges 1/4, 1/6, 1/12 of the diameter of the ring. The first time the word cell was used to refer to these tiny units of life was in 1665 by a British scientist named Robert Hooke. Hooke was one of the earliest scientists to study living things under a microscope. The microscopes of his day were not very strong, but Hooke was still able to make an important discovery. The best tool to use for cutting cork is a utility knife. Utility knives have a sharp, retractable blade and come in either fixed or folding versions. Happy Slice Co. in Flatbush, Brooklyn, which is under the same ownership as Cork & Slice in the Five …Aug 15, 2016 · Cork is the bark of the cork oak, Quercus suber, which grows in Mediterranean climates. Pliny, in his Natural History (A.D. 77), describes it: “The cork-oak is a small tree, and its acorns are bad in quality and few in number; its only useful product is its bark which is extremely thick and which, when cut, grows again.” Natural cork stoppers also present some unique aging benefits, as some of the oxygen “trapped” in the cellular structure of the cork interacts with the wine, allowing it to reach its full potential. However, not all cork is fit for natural cork stoppers, as the planks need to meet specific requirements in order to be usable for this purpose..
